Chris Holm signs with Shiga Lakestars
Chris Holm (212 cm, Vermont ‘07) has signed with Shiga Lakestars (Japan-BJ League). The American Center played in Japan last season as well when he posted 9.1 ppg and 12.1 rpg for the Kyoto Hannaryz (Japan-JBL). Walker Russell (183 cm, Jacksonville State’06) will continue his professional career in Cyprus this 2014-15, playing for Forex Time Apollon Limassol. The 32-year-old veteran left Galatasaray Liv Hospital Istanbul (Turkey-TBL) after a one month contract. He signed with NBA D-League team the Reno Bighorns in March 2014.
